How to make a decorated gift box

1. Gather Your Supplies

  • Plain box – I prefer wood/cardboard, but you could try some other materials.  Michael’s and Hobby Lobby have a good assortment.
  • Acrylic paints
  • paint brushes
  • decorations such as photos, stencils, tissue paper, pressed flowers, ticket stubs, etc.
  • Modge Podge

2.  Paint your box with the acrylic paints and add decorations using Modge Podge as an adherent.

Get creative.  Find sentimental photos, ticket stubs, flowers from the yard – anything that would be meaningful to the recipient.

3.  Once your box is decorated coat with Modge Podge to seal.

4. Let it dry.

It’s that easy.

Then, you can fill your box with all kinds of goodies such as snacks, gadgets, gift cards, and more.
